summ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Matthew McClintock <msm@freescale.com>2011-10-26 22:09:20 -0500
committerMatthew McClintock <msm@freescale.com>2011-10-26 22:09:20 -0500
commitcf755ddd160696065b6912d50a826a1519cda870 (patch)
treebba8b6aa366ccd8dafa42bd7dba39a0d5b5c6fe2
parentb19fb276a19819d861320fed8da156c1584f2de4 (diff)
downloadmeta-freescale-cf755ddd160696065b6912d50a826a1519cda870.tar.gz
Add fsl-toolchain-bare for just barebones toolchain
Make fsl-toolchain build from the -bare version and we can start adding nativesdk package such as qemu and dtc there Signed-off-by: Matthew McClintock <msm@freescale.com>
-rw-r--r--meta-fsl-ppc/images/fsl-toolchain-bare.bb8
-rw-r--r--meta-fsl-ppc/images/fsl-toolchain.bb8
2 files changed, 12 insertions, 4 deletions
diff --git a/meta-fsl-ppc/images/fsl-toolchain-bare.bb b/meta-fsl-ppc/images/fsl-toolchain-bare.bb
new file mode 100644
index 00000000..16f32981
--- /dev/null
+++ b/meta-fsl-ppc/images/fsl-toolchain-bare.bb
@@ -0,0 +1,8 @@
1PR = "r3"
2
3require recipes-core/meta/meta-toolchain.bb
4
5TOOLCHAIN_OUTPUTNAME = "${SDK_NAME}-toolchain-bare-${DISTRO_VERSION}"
6TOOLCHAIN_TARGET_TASK = "task-core-standalone-sdk-target"
7TOOLCHAIN_HOST_TASK = "task-cross-canadian-${TRANSLATED_TARGET_ARCH}"
8TOOLCHAIN_NEED_CONFIGSITE_CACHE += "zlib"
diff --git a/meta-fsl-ppc/images/fsl-toolchain.bb b/meta-fsl-ppc/images/fsl-toolchain.bb
index db8bdf28..ec2d424a 100644
--- a/meta-fsl-ppc/images/fsl-toolchain.bb
+++ b/meta-fsl-ppc/images/fsl-toolchain.bb
@@ -1,8 +1,8 @@
1PR = "r1" 1PR = "r1"
2 2
3TOOLCHAIN_OUTPUTNAME ?= "${SDK_NAME}-toolchain-${DISTRO_VERSION}" 3require fsl-toolchain-bare.bb
4require recipes-core/meta/meta-toolchain.bb
5 4
6TOOLCHAIN_HOST_TASK = "dtc-nativesdk" 5TOOLCHAIN_OUTPUTNAME = "${SDK_NAME}-toolchain-${DISTRO_VERSION}"
6TOOLCHAIN_TARGET_TASK += ""
7TOOLCHAIN_HOST_TASK += "dtc-nativesdk qemu-nativesdk"
7 8
8TOOLCHAIN_NEED_CONFIGSITE_CACHE += "zlib"